1. Market Analysis:
Understanding the current market trends and demands for sports bars restaurants in Long Beach is crucial for success. Analyze the target audience, competition, and local preferences to tailor your establishment accordingly. Consider factors like proximity to sports venues, customer demographics, and the popularity of specific sports in the area.
2. Solid Business Plan:
Develop a comprehensive business plan that includes market research, financial projections, marketing strategies, and a detailed layout for your sports bars restaurant. Ensure that your plan addresses legal requirements, zoning regulations, and licenses necessary to operate in Long Beach, CA.
3. Legal Compliance:
Comply with all federal, state, and local laws and regulations pertaining to the food and beverage industry in Long Beach. Acquire necessary permits such as food handler’s permits and liquor licenses. Stay updated on health inspections, labor laws, and any legal changes that may impact your business operations.
4. Staffing and Training:
Invest in skilled and courteous staff who are passionate about sports and customer service. Provide thorough training on menu ingredients, food safety practices, and proper serving techniques. Maintain a positive and motivated work environment to reduce employee turnover and ensure quality service.
5. Financial Management:
- Implement effective financial management practices to mitigate financial risks. Regularly review revenue and expense reports, maintain accurate accounting records, and budget accordingly.
- Consider consulting with financial professionals to optimize tax planning and minimize liabilities.
6. Marketing and Promotion:
Develop a robust marketing strategy to increase brand visibility and attract customers. Utilize social media platforms, local advertising, and partnerships with sports leagues or teams to target the desired audience. Offer unique promotions, such as gamenight specials or themed events, to entice customers and keep them coming back.
7. Food Safety and Quality Control:
Maintain the highest standards of food safety and quality control to ensure customer satisfaction and prevent potential sanitary issues. Regularly train staff on proper food handling and storage techniques. Partner with trusted suppliers to guarantee the freshness and integrity of ingredients.
8. Customer Experience:
Focus on providing an exceptional customer experience to build loyalty and positive wordofmouth. Create a welcoming atmosphere with comfortable seating, multiple screens for viewing sports events, and a wellstocked bar. Incorporate interactive elements like sports trivia, game predictions, or live commentary to engage customers and enhance their overall experience.
